产品介绍 |
The HRASLS2 gene belongs to the H-REV107 gene family, which is involved in the regulation of cell growth and differentiation. HRASLS2 is expressed at high levels in normal tissues of the small intestine, kidney and trachea. Function: Exhibits PLA1/2 activity, catalyzing the calcium-independent hydrolysis of acyl groups in various phosphotidylcholines (PC) and phosphatidylethanolamine (PE). For most substrates, PLA1 activity is much higher than PLA2 activity. Catalyzes N-acylation of PE using both sn-1 and sn-2 palmitoyl groups of PC as acyl donor. Also catalyzes O-acylation converting lyso-PC into PC. Subcellular Location: Cytoplasm. Note=Exhibits a granular pattern in the cytoplasm with preferential perinuclear localization. Tissue Specificity: Expressed in liver, kidney, small intestine testis and colon (PubMed:19615464). Undetectable in testis, placenta, salivary gland and fetal brain (PubMed:18163183).
